A bullet with mass m = 0,004 kg is
fired into a block of wood with mass M =
0,200 kg at rest on a horizontal surface. After impact, the block
with embedded bullet slides a
distance x = 8,00 m before coming to
rest. If the impulse exerted by friction on the block with bullet
is 1,62 N.s, what was the speed of the
bullet before impact?
